Protein Variants

Protein Variants Comment Organism
F454A the mutant shows about 40fold reduced catalytic efficiency compared to the wild type enzyme Trametes ochracea
F454Y the mutant shows about 3.5fold reduced catalytic efficiency compared to the wild type enzyme Trametes ochracea

Inhibitors

Inhibitors Comment Organism Structure
H2O2 oxidation of Phe454, which is located at the flexible active-site loop of the enzyme, is the first and main step in the inactivation of the enzyme by hydrogen peroxide Trametes ochracea
